ADS1115 — 16-битный Аналого-Цифровой Преобразователь с I2C интерфейсом. Модуль RI038

ADS1115 - 16-битный Аналого-Цифровой Преобразователь с I2C интерфейсом. Модуль RI038

Микросхема ADS1115 — это 4-х канальный 16-битный аналого-цифровой преобразователь (АЦП). ADS1115 разработано для обеспечения точности, энергоэффективности, простоты в реализации, выполняет преобразование с программируемыми скоростями обработки данных до 860 выб./с, потребляемый ток питания составляет всего 150 мкА (ном.), а рабочее напряжение снижено до 2 В. Встроенный усилитель с программируемым коэффициентом усиления (PGA) предлагает диапазоны входных сигналов от ±256 мВ …

Подключение ультразвукового дальномера HC-SR04 к Arduino

Схема подключения I2C PCF8574 LCD1602 и HC-SR04 к Arduino

Ультразвуковой дальномер HC-SR04 предназначен для измерения расстояния от устройства до объекта. Работа модуля основана на принципе эхолокации. Модуль посылает ультразвуковой сигнал и принимает его отражение от объекта. Измерив время между отправкой и получением импульса, не сложно вычислить расстояние до препятствия. Поскольку в основе работы устройства используется ультразвук, модуль плохо подходит для определения расстояния до звукопоглощающих объектов. …

RTC DS3231 — высокоточные часы реального времени

RTC DS3231 - высокоточные часы реального времени

DS3231 — высокоточные часы реального времени (real-time clock, RTC) со встроенными I2C интерфейсом, термокомпенсированным кварцевым генератором (TCXO) и кварцевым резонатором. Прибор имеет вход для подключения резервного автономного источника питания, позволяющего осуществлять хронометрирование и измерение температуры даже при отключенном основном напряжении питания. Встроенный кварцевый резонатор повышает срок службы прибора и уменьшает необходимое количество внешних элементов. DS3231 …

DHT12 — I2C датчик влажности и температуры

DHT12 - I2C датчик влажности и температуры

DHT12 — это датчик температуры и влажности предназначен для одновременного замера температуры и влажности. Сенсор состоит из емкостного сенсора влажности и термистора, он также содержит в себе простой 8-битовый микроконтроллер, который хранит калибровочные поправки для датчиков и выполняет функцию АЦП. Данный датчик может быть подключен к любому микроконтроллеру, в том числе к Arduino. Этот датчик …

TSL2561 — Цифровой датчик освещенности (модуль GY-2561)

TSL2561 - Цифровой датчик освещенности (модуль GY-2561)

Датчик TSL2561 интегрирует на кристалле два канала измерения интенсивности падающего излучения: канал 0 с откликом в широком участке спектра, включающем видимый и инфракрасный диапазоны, и канал 1 с откликом в более узком участке, включающем только инфракрасный диапазон. В каждом канале имеется свой первичный оптический датчик — фотодиод с соответствующим спектром отклика. Сигналы от фотодиодов каждого …

Подключение LCD1602 к Arduino по I2C (HD44780/PCF8574)

Схема подключения LCD1602 к Arduino по I2C(HD44780 - PCF8574)

Подключить LCD1602 к Arduino (или любой другой LCD на базе микросхем HD44780) не всегда удобно, потому что используются как минимум 6 цифровых выходов. LCD I2C модули на базе микросхем PCF8574 позволяют подключить символьный дисплей к плате Arduino всего по двум сигнальным проводам (SDA и SCL). PCF8574 — I2C модуль для LCD на базе HD44780 Микросхема PCF8574/PCF8574T …

Установка драйвера PL2303 на Windows 10 и 8

PL2303HX USB-USART

Преобразователь USB-TTL PL2303 — это небольшой USB модуль, который эмулирует последовательный интерфейс UART (RS-232). То есть подключая этот преобразователь в USB порт компьютера, виртуально создается COM порт. В октябре года 2012 Фирма Prolific прекратили производство и поддержку микросхем UART PL2303X (Chip Rev A) и PL2303X HX (Chip Rev A), а начала производить микросхем PL2303TA. Но и сейчас, можно купить …

Raspberry Pi и Pi4J. Урок 8. Работа с DHT11 и DHT22 из Java и C/C++

Схема подключения DHT11 к Orange Pi One

В этой статье подключим датчики DHT11 и DHT22 к Raspberry Pi, а точнее к Orange Pi PC, так как эта плата у меня есть. В принципе это не имеет значения, потому что ниже приведённые библиотеки и примеры запустятся и на Banana Pi, Odroid и NanoPi. Это что касается примеров на Java, использующие библиотеки Pi4J. А примеры на …

Arduino Pro Mini — Характеристики, распиновка, описание платы

Arduino Pro Mini 328 5V 16MHz

Arduino Pro Mini одина из самых миниатюрных плат семейства Arduino и может использоваться в готовых проектах. Разработана и производится SparkFun Electronics. Построена на микроконтроллере ATmega168, а позже вышла плата на базе микроконтроллера ATmega328. Платформа содержит 14 цифровых входов и выходов (6 из которых могут использоваться как выходы ШИМ), 6 аналоговых входов, резонатор, кнопку перезагрузки и отверстия для …

Arduino Nano V3.0 — Характеристики, распиновка, драйвера, описание платы

Arduino Nano FT232RL FTDI

Платформа Arduino Nano (рус. Ардуино Нано) — открытая и компактная платформа с семейства Arduino, построенная на микроконтроллере ATmega328 (Arduino Nano 3.0) или ATmega168 (Arduino Nano 2.x), имеет небольшие размеры и может использоваться в лабораторных работах. Arduino Nano — это уменьшенный аналог Arduino Uno, отличается формфактором платы, которая в 2-2.5 раза меньше (19 x 43 мм), чем …